I believe I heard about users having a similar issue in the past, but I am not sure. Searching for the term 'lag' did not help me as all I found was users happy about the Touch not being as laggy as the Mogul.

All of the sudden my Sprint Touch has a very annoying lag. For example, phone rings and I click the softkey ANSWER. The softkey looks like it's being clicked on, but kind of freezes in between so you can see it frozen on a different color. The ringtone is still playing, however, even 10-15 seconds have passed since actually clicking the Answer softkey to my phone actually answering the call.

This also happens when minimizing, opening, clicking reply on an SMS or e-mail, switching tabs on the HTC Home plugin... you get the idea.

I don't have much on it: Resco, TouchPal, Delete All/Mark All as Read add-on, Newsbreak, e-Wallet. I think this started when using Windows Live Messenger, then I saw the lag when using the OZ IM app and unsintalled it.

After running SK Tools and clearing almost everything I could, it went back to normal... now, out of the blue, it started again. It makes the phone useless since I can't even answer calls and I have no clue what's causing it.

Any ideas?

Pibe38,

Do you have any software to track what programs are running in the background? It sounds like a program is running and has control of the cpu. It may be the IM program. I'm guessing about that because I don't have it installed. It seems that something is constantly polling either the cpu or ?net which is degrading your speed.

Try to isolate what programs are running at what demand on resources they are using. acbPocketSoft's acbTaskman can help you with this. Hope this helps you out.
